April is an exceptional time to visit Cortona Old Town, as this charming Tuscan destination begins to bloom in spring. During this month, the weather is pleasantly mild, with temperatures averaging around 10 to 20 degrees Celsius, ideal for outdoor exploration and leisurely strolls through the historic streets. Visitors can take part in the vibrant local culture, enjoying the blossoming gardens and picturesque views that the region is renowned for.
The peak tourist season runs from July to September, when the town attracts a larger crowd seeking the warmth of the Italian summer. This bustling period is great for those who enjoy a lively option, as various festivals and events take place, adding to the vibrancy of the area. However, if you prefer a more tranquil experience with fewer tourists, April offers a delightful balance of pleasant weather and fewer crowds, making it easier to appreciate the stunning architecture and stunning landscapes.
For those looking for a more budget-friendly option, January is typically the low season in Cortona. While the weather can be cooler, with temperatures dipping to around 0 to 10 degrees Celsius, it provides a unique opportunity to experience the town's charm without the hustle and bustle of peak tourist traffic.
Ultimately, the best time to visit Cortona Old Town hinges on your preferences.
